Immerse yourself in the timeless beauty of classical music with Kathleen Ferrier's enchanting album, "Bach, J.S.: Ascension Oratorio, BWV 11 / Arias / Handel G.F.: Arias." Released on August 26, 2008, this captivating collection showcases the extraordinary talent of Kathleen Ferrier, a renowned contralto whose voice has left an indelible mark on the world of classical music.
The album is a masterful blend of compositions by two of the most celebrated composers in history, Johann Sebastian Bach and George Frideric Handel. It features a selection of arias and choral works that span a variety of moods and themes, from the profound and introspective to the jubilant and triumphant. The centerpiece of the album is Bach's Ascension Oratorio, BWV 11, a stunning work that showcases the composer's unparalleled ability to convey the depths of human emotion through music.
In addition to the Ascension Oratorio, the album also includes a selection of arias from Bach's Mass in B Minor, BWV 232, and St. Matthew Passion, BWV 244, as well as arias from Handel's Samson, HWV 57, and Messiah, HWV 56.
